TELECOM NAMIBIA WARNS COPPER THEFT THREATENS INFRASTRUCTURE

Breadcrumb

1 month ago By NBC Online

Telecom Namibia has warned that the escalating copper theft is threatening critical telecommunications infrastructure and putting lives at risk, calling for stronger law enforcement and government intervention.

MURD LAUNCHES 2025/26–2029/30 STRATEGIC PLAN

Breadcrumb

1 month ago By NBC Online

The Ministry of Urban and Rural Development launched its strategic plan 2025/26 to 2029/30 in Windhoek today.

The plan will serve as its management and implementation tool towards its achievements for Vision 2030 and the Sixth National Development Plan (NDP6).

MINISTER WARNS AGAINST SELLING GOVERNMENT-ALLOCATED PLOTS

Breadcrumb

1 month ago By NBC Online

Urban and Rural Development Minister James Sankwasa has warned residents against selling plots allocated to them for free by the government. 

Sankwasa addressed the community of Orwetoveni's extensions 16 and 17 at Otjiwarongo.
